SpletGood shorebird watching is often available around the San Diego River mouths and around Mission Bay. Contact the San Diego Audubon or Buena Vista Audubon Societies for more birding information. Splet17. jul. 2024 · Boobies are a type of seabird that can be found throughout the tropical oceans of the world. These birds are excellent swimmers and can often be seen diving into the water in pursuit of fish. Boobies typically nest on remote islands or coastlines, making them difficult for predators to reach. 9. Brown Pelicans. SpletFAMILY : Snipes, Godwits, Curlews, Whimbrels, Stints, Sandpipers. Common Sandpiper. (Actitis hypoleucos) The Common Sandpiper is a wader with grey brown back and white underside. The legs are yellow brown. The eye has white line above it and small white semi circle below forming a white eye ring. The bill is straight and pointed, and dark grey ... SpletThe Hackensack Meadowlands are an historic waystation for migrating shorebirds. New Jersey Audubon’s Rich Kane did seminal work on southbound shorebirds, there in the 1970s, summarized in Records of New Jersey Birds as an “Occasional Paper.”.
